| 240 Replacement windscreen glass
 Sigge Redhe contacted the V8 Webmaster for help in tracking 
            down a source of supply for a replacement RV8 windscreen glass. Al 
            Barnett provides the information. (Mar 06)
 Unfortunately 
              during the restoration of the windscreen of his RV8, he removed 
              the glass from the windscreen surround and placed it on its "back" 
              on the table where it remained for a couple of months while he restored 
              his rusted windscreen surround. Unfortunately it cracked in the 
              middle, so needed a new one. Sigge enquired whether we knew if that 
              glass is the similar to the glass used in another MG or any other 
              Rover model? If not, what do other owners do in a similar situation?
 | Al Barnett responded 
            with some useful help: There is a firm called Uroglas advertising 
            new RV8 screens on Ebay, price £157 including delivery. They 
            are a stock item and he purchased one for a spare. It arrived in the 
            most elaborate packing Al had ever seen, a wooden frame about 6 feet 
            by 4 feet. It took him a day to dismantle it, remove literally dozens 
            of nails and then convert it to firewood! The firm operate out of 
            Redditch in the south west Midlands and gave me very good service. 
            I have also purchased a rubber screen seal and top of screen seal 
            from Brown & Gammons at Baldock costing £139.00 with postage 
            and packing.
